How It All Started

The 50

Vanshaj Singh was the first contestant eliminated on Day 1 of The 50, with Karan Patel citing his limited interaction with other contestants as the reason for his exit. Disney Food Blog That decision set off a firestorm.

After his exit, Vanshaj made headlines for lashing out at Karan Patel and Prince Narula during interviews and on social media — his strong statements and unapologetic attitude kept him in the news even after leaving the palace.

His sharpest line? Calling Karan “uncle” repeatedly — and he stood firm when backlash came. Vanshaj strongly defended himself, saying “Respect is earned, not demanded,” and called out what he described as Karan’s “god complex” mindset toward people he considered beneath him.

The Re-Entry That Changed Everything

Vanshaj Singh has officially re-entered the show as a wildcard, while Karan Patel also returned after a brief medical absence following a rib injury sustained during a task — re-entering after receiving full medical clearance. Wikipedia

A new promo revealed the house is now sharply divided — Prince Narula and Neelam backing Karan’s return, while Mr. Faisu, Rajat, and Nehal rallied behind Vanshaj.

And the tension? When both stood face to face, Vanshaj refused to greet Karan — a moment that instantly went viral and sent the internet into a frenzy.

Gen-Z vs Old Guard

At its core, this isn’t just personal drama — it’s a generational clash. As reality television continues to blur the lines between traditional celebrities and digital creators, The 50 is putting that tension front and centre. Karan and Prince sparked controversy by suggesting that YouTubers and influencers were responsible for the decline of the TV industry — a statement Vanshaj called pure insecurity. Change.org
